Climate overview of Langlir

The climate in Langlir, Luxembourg Province, Belgium, is marked by large temperature swings across the seasons, ranging from 22°C (72°F) in July to 4°C (39°F) in January.

Rain/snowfall is high, totalling around 1108 mm (44 in) per year. December is the wettest month and April the driest. The city also experiences warm summers and cold winters. May is the sunniest month, averaging 6.5 hours of sunshine per day.

Monthly Temperature in Langlir

In Langlir, temperatures differ significantly between summer and winter months. Average maximum daytime temperatures range from a comfortable 22°C (72°F) in July, the warmest time of the year, to a chilly 4°C (39°F) during cooler months like January.

At night, you can expect temperatures ranging from 12°C (54°F) in July to around -1°C (30°F) during January.

Rainfall in Langlir

Langlir experiences significant rain/snowfall throughout the year, averaging 1108 mm (44 in) of precipitation annually. Year-round, Langlir has a balanced climate with minimal variation in precipitation. The difference between the wettest month, December, with 112 mm (4.4 in), and the driest month, April, with 76 mm (3 in), is minimal. For more details, please visit our Langlir Precipitation page.

Sunshine Hours in Langlir

Seasonal changes in sunshine hours are quite dramatic in Langlir. While May receives considerable daily sunshine with up to 6.5 hours, December marks the darkest time of the year, where sunshine is scarce with only 1.5 hours of sunlight per day.

Best Time to Visit Langlir

Conditions in Langlir are generally most comfortable in July and August. They are typically least comfortable in January, February, March, November and December.

Monthly ratings reflect general weather comfort, based on daytime temperature and rainfall. Swimming and winter conditions are highlighted separately where relevant.

  • Best overall: July and August
  • Warmest weather: July and August
  • Most sunshine: May and June
  • Seasonal pattern: Warm summers and cold winters
  • Coldest conditions: January, with freezing nights around -1°C (30°F).
